Sort by:
Special Pink Roses
From £40.99
Spanish Flamenco Dancer
From £40.99
Soft Red Rose Close-Up
From £40.99
Soft Pink Centre
From £40.99
Single White Rose
From £40.99
Single Red Rose
From £40.99
Single Red Rose For The One I Love
From £40.99
Single Pink Rose Bud
From £40.99
Single Pink Rose
From £40.99
Single Cream Rose
From £40.99
Rose Petals In Bloom
From £40.99
Rose Petal Beauty Red
From £40.99
Rose coloured flower
From £40.99
Rose B n W
From £40.99
Red Twisted Silk
From £40.99
Red Rose Velvet Petals
From £40.99
Red Rose On A Sea Of B n W
From £40.99
Red Rose In Bloom
From £40.99
Red Rose Close-Up Twins
From £40.99
Red Rose Centre
From £40.99
Red Rose Center Dew
From £40.99
Red Rose Black Velvet
From £40.99
Red Rose Beauty
From £40.99
Red On Baby Blue
From £40.99
Red Love Tree
From £40.99
Red Lips On Pokerdots
From £40.99
Red Gerbera Fallen Petals
From £40.99
Red Galore
From £40.99
Red dying flowers
From £40.99
Red Bubbles
From £40.99
Reasons To Love Someone
From £40.99
Purple Love
From £40.99